Abstract
PURPOSE: Following the International Classification of Functioning, Disability and Health (ICF) concepts, this study examines body functions such as sensory modulation and sleep quality among adults with learning disabilities (LD).Entities:

Sensory processing levels in each group for the four AASP subscales scores (percentages).
| AASP subscales | Lower than most people % | Similar to most people % | Higher than most people % | χ² | P-value | |||
|---|---|---|---|---|---|---|---|---|
| LD | Control | LD | Control | LD | Control | |||
| Low registration | 3.6 | 12.7 | 40 | 80 | 56.4 | 7.3 | 30.940 | <.001 |
| Sensory seeking | 29.1 | 9.1 | 60 | 81.8 | 10.9 | 9.1 | 7.699 | 0.021 |
| Sensory sensitivity | 1.8 | 3.6 | 34.5 | 81.8 | 63.6 | 14.5 | 27.849 | <.001 |
| Sensory avoidance | 9.1 | 10.9 | 56.4 | 81.8 | 34.5 | 7.3 | 12.452 | 0.002 |

Means and standard deviations of MSQ scores in both groups.
| MSQ scores | LD | Control | p-value |
|---|---|---|---|
| Sleep quality X(SD) | 3.10 (0.77) | 2.38 (0.55) | <.001 |
| Insomnia X(SD) | 10.40 (3.27) | 8.14 (2.51) | .019 |
*Higher grades indicate lower sleep quality/more tendencies for insomnia.
